How Pilates can complement physical therapy

Pilates can help support many of the goals addressed in physical therapy, including:

  • Improving body awareness and movement confidence
  • Building core strength and stability
  • Enhancing mobility and posture
  • Supporting long-term movement habits

How massage therapy can complement physical therapy

Massage therapy can support physical therapy by helping you:

  • Reduce stress and promote relaxation
  • Improve body awareness and proprioception
  • Support recovery between sessions
  • Enhance movement comfort and overall wellbeing
